			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Bunk beds are really fun to have but they can also be dangerous if not used properly.&nbsp; If you are thinking about getting a bunk bed, then check out these tips first.&nbsp; <BR><BR>First, print off the <a title="Federal Bunk Bed Safety Guidelines" href="http://www.onlybunkbeds.net/federal_bunk_bed_safety_guidelines-9434.php" target=_self>federal bunk bed safety guidelines</a> and.&nbsp; They change every so often and sometimes retailers will want you to think that the model they are showing you is up to date with all <a title="Bunk Bed Safety" href="http://www.onlybunkbeds.net/bunk_bed_safety/" target=_self>bunk bed safety</a> features.&nbsp; Just because a salesman says it is doesn&#8217;t mean that it is.&nbsp; They can be very helpful but they don&#8217;t always know the most recent information about the product they are selling.<BR><BR>If you have young children, ones that are younger than the teenage years, get <a href="http://www.technorati.com/tag/bunk%2Bbed" rel="tag nofollow">bunk bed</a> guard rails.&nbsp; Make sure that they are really good and sturdy and will support your child if she rolls a lot during the night.&nbsp; If your child has a history of rolling off the bed, get them guard rails too, even if they are older. <BR><BR>Make sure that the bunk bed is pushed all the way to the wall.&nbsp; Children have gotten caught in between the bed, in normal beds too, and have died.&nbsp; Put guard rails up on both sides if it makes you feel more comfortable.&nbsp; Most <a href="http://www.technorati.com/tag/bunk%2Bbeds" rel="tag nofollow">bunk beds</a> only come with one but you can always buy more.&nbsp; <BR><BR>Sometimes the mattress foundation comes off.&nbsp; It is usually caused by someone kicking the bottom of the top bunk mattress from the bottom bunk.&nbsp; Tell your children that kicking the mattress is not allowed and explain why.&nbsp; Check the bed every night to make sure that the mattress and the support beams are in place.&nbsp; <BR><BR>When you are getting a new mattress for the bunk bed, make sure that the mattress is going to be the perfect fit.&nbsp; Most manufacturers sell replacement mattresses for the bunk beds so try buying one from them.&nbsp; The mattresses have to be a specific size or there will be too much of a gap in between the bed and mattress.&nbsp; It can cause suffocation.&nbsp; <BR><BR>Children love jumping off the bed and that is especially true for bunk beds.&nbsp; Make sure that you buy a bunk bed that has a ladder and that your children know to climb up and down when getting into bed.&nbsp; It will save a lot of injuries and from your children hurting themselves.&nbsp; Most <a title="Only Bunk Beds" href="http://www.onlybunkbeds.net/" target=_self>bunk beds</a> come with ladders, but if yours doesn&#8217;t then make sure you buy one or you can even make one by getting some materials from your local hardware store.&nbsp; Have your child help and he will even want to use the ladder.&nbsp; <BR><BR>When you buy a bunk bed you have to be very careful.&nbsp; They are really fun for children and it makes them feel more adventurous.&nbsp; Just make sure that you warn them and tell them that any disobeying of the rules will not be tolerated.&nbsp; You have to warn them because there are dangers that they might not realize or think would really harm them.&nbsp; Just use these <a href="http://www.technorati.com/tag/bunk%2Bbed%2Bsafety" rel="tag nofollow">bunk bed safety</a> tips when buying your next bunk bed.&nbsp; <BR>
